Why Is Financial Counseling Important for Couples in Rehab?

Financial issues are often intertwined with addiction. Individuals and couples struggling with substance use disorders frequently face financial instability due to job loss, overspending on substances, or legal issues. When both partners are in recovery, the stress of financial struggles can cause additional tension in their relationship. This can be particularly challenging for couples who are trying to rebuild their lives together while overcoming addiction.

Financial counseling in rehab can provide couples with the tools they need to manage their finances, set financial goals, and work through any existing debt or financial obligations. This support allows couples to address the root causes of their financial troubles and develop healthy financial habits for a successful future.


How Does Financial Counseling Work in Inpatient Rehab for Couples?

At Trinity Behavioral Health, financial counseling is integrated into the overall treatment program. Couples in rehab can benefit from individual and joint counseling sessions that focus on understanding their financial situation and how it impacts their recovery. Here are some of the key components of financial counseling:

  1. Assessing Financial Health
    The first step in financial counseling is understanding the couple’s current financial situation. Financial counselors work with couples to assess their income, expenses, debt, and savings. This initial assessment helps identify any urgent financial issues that need to be addressed.

  2. Debt Management
    Debt is a significant concern for many individuals in recovery. Financial counselors help couples create a plan to manage and reduce their debt, including addressing credit card debt, medical bills, loans, or any other outstanding obligations. The goal is to create a manageable repayment plan and relieve the couple from the stress of unpaid debts.

  3. Budgeting and Financial Planning
    Learning how to budget effectively is an essential part of financial counseling. Couples are taught how to track their income and expenses, set realistic financial goals, and prioritize their spending. Developing a budget helps couples live within their means and start saving for their future.

  4. Financial Communication
    Money is often a sensitive topic for couples in recovery. Financial counseling provides a safe space for couples to discuss their financial issues openly and honestly. This communication is essential for building trust and understanding, especially when both partners may have different views on money or financial priorities.

  5. Financial Goals and Future Planning
    Financial counseling helps couples set long-term financial goals, whether it’s buying a home, saving for retirement, or building an emergency fund. Couples are encouraged to think about their financial future and make plans that support their overall recovery journey.


How Financial Counseling Supports the Couple’s Recovery Journey

Financial counseling provides couples with tools to regain control over their finances and reduce financial stress, which is often a significant barrier to recovery. Here’s how it supports the recovery process:

  1. Reduces Stress
    Financial instability can create a constant source of stress for couples. This stress can trigger negative emotions and increase the risk of relapse. By addressing financial issues head-on and creating a plan to move forward, couples can reduce anxiety and stay focused on their recovery.

  2. Strengthens the Relationship
    Money problems are one of the leading causes of conflict in relationships. By working together with a financial counselor, couples can strengthen their relationship through open communication and shared financial goals. This collaborative effort fosters trust and unity, which are vital for successful long-term recovery.

  3. Promotes Financial Independence
    Financial counseling helps couples regain control of their financial situation, promoting independence and self-sufficiency. Achieving financial stability is an important milestone in recovery, as it reduces the likelihood of returning to unhealthy financial habits that may have contributed to addiction in the past.

  4. Empowers the Couple to Make Informed Decisions
    With the right financial tools and resources, couples can make more informed decisions about their finances. Whether it’s choosing a savings plan or deciding on a financial strategy for paying off debt, financial counseling equips couples with the knowledge they need to make responsible choices.
